    I've owned two of these trucks, one an '07 and the other a 2010. Both were and are 4x4 TRD offroads. The 2007 ran around on a 3" lift turning 285/75/r16 BFG KM2's. That truck got 90,000 miles down the road before the bearings gave out. The 2010 is all stock and running 265/75/r16 KM2's and i only got 78,000 out of the bearings on it.

    Just got to thinking and was curious what y'all are getting out of your trucks milage wise on bearings. Tell if the truck is lifted, tire size, what type of tire and milage.
